Legal Assistant 

Position Overview:
We are seeking a highly organized and proactive Legal Assistant to join our team in our Cleveland office, supporting our Ohio practice group.

The ideal candidate will assist in managing administrative projects and workflow, maintaining communication with clients and stakeholders, and supporting attorneys within the practice group. This role requires excellent communication skills, proficiency in office software, and the ability to handle multiple tasks efficiently.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Draft and send basic correspondence; draft basic legal documents.
  • Manage and maintain assigned case docket, including scheduling, tracking deadlines, preparing evidence submissions, communicating with witnesses, and maintaining digital case files.
  • Assist with administrative functions during annual assessment review cycle.
  • Communicating with county or other governmental entities.
  • Field/screen/direct incoming phone calls, taking accurate messages while interacting professionally with colleagues, clients, other firm professionals, court personnel, co-counsel, etc.
  • Provide administrative support as needed.
  • Deliver exceptional service to clients and opposing counsel through effective communication and professional interaction.
  • Collaborate closely with other members of the practice administrative group and assist attorneys as needed, fostering a supportive and efficient team environment.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ned by supervisors.

Skills and Abilities:

  • Digital Literacy - Microsoft Office, Word, Excel, information evaluation, communication, security awareness.
  • Basic math skills and the ability to convert percentages to decimals and work with fractions.
  • Strong attention to detail and organizational skills.
  • Flexible contributor who thrives in a dynamic environment and readily assists across functions.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ills and the ability to interact professionally with a diverse team and diverse client base in a professional, service-oriented manner.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and ability to work independently.
  • The ability to manage multiple priorities and work effectively under pressure in a fast-paced environment. 
  • Comfortable giving and receiving feedback.

Experience and Education:

  • Preferred experience in a law firm environment with familiarity with litigation terminology.
  • Minimum of 2-3 years of administrative office experience.
  • Bachelor or Associate degree strongly preferred.
  • Knowledge or experience in real estate/appraisal is advantageous.

Working Conditions/Physical Demands:

  • Ability to perform light work, including occasional lifting of up to 20 pounds.
  • Manual dexterity to operate standard office equipment.
  • Work primarily in a typical office setting.
  • Willingness to work more than 35 hours per week during busy periods, with mandatory full-time office presence during specific periods.

Hybrid Work Model:
During the training period, the role requires full-time office attendance for five days a week. After completion, the position will transition to a hybrid schedule.
